One of the most iconic types of india candle holders is the traditional brass holder. Brass is a popular metal used in Indian craftsmanship due to its durability and malleability. Brass candle holders are often adorned with intricate carvings, filigree work, or embossed patterns that reflect the country’s rich cultural heritage. These holders come in various shapes and sizes, from simple taper holders to elaborate candelabras, making them versatile pieces that can suit any décor style.
In addition to brass, India is also known for its stunning glass candle holders. Glass blowing is a traditional art form in India, and artisans are skilled at creating intricate designs and shapes using colored glass. These candle holders often feature vibrant hues and patterns, adding a pop of color to any room. Whether placed on a dining table, mantelpiece, or coffee table, glass candle holders from India are sure to catch the eye and create a warm, inviting atmosphere.
Wooden candle holders are another popular choice in India, showcasing the country’s rich woodworking tradition. Crafted from local hardwoods such as rosewood, teak, or mango wood, these holders often feature intricate carvings or inlaid designs that highlight the natural beauty of the wood. Wooden candle holders bring a touch of rustic charm to any space and can be a perfect complement to traditional or bohemian décor styles.
India’s ceramic candle holders are also a sight to behold, with their hand-painted motifs and vibrant colors. Ceramic artisans in India are known for their skillful use of glazes and decorative techniques, creating unique pieces that are both functional and visually appealing. Whether showcasing traditional Indian motifs like paisleys and floral designs or more contemporary patterns, ceramic candle holders from India are sure to add a touch of sophistication to your home.
